      <description>Sorry, don't get this.  The largest single batch of Eacocks is in Herefordshire, somewhere round Colwall, and according to the IGI goes back to at least the 1790s.  The Birmingham group may well be outliers of this.  There is also a group in Suffolk which my wife comes from, and which I thought you did too, Roger?  However, that goes back to at least the 1760s. This talk about the US line mostly stemming from Hereford in 1874 and you being related to it, are you saying that there is a close link between the Hereford and Suffolk lines in the early 19th century, despite both groups going back considerably further?&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;There is also one family in Essex c.1820; reckons they are outliers from the Suffolk group, but can't fit them in yet.&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;Anybody who wants a tree of the Suffolk group, please ask.</description>

      <description>&lt;br&gt;I have just discovered your correspondence with my son Roger .&lt;br&gt;I have found no connection with the Hereford family and my branch in Suffolk .Various spellings go back to the 1500's . Warren was born 1773 in Bacton Suffolk . He had 2 sons-Robert &lt;br&gt;(b) 1812 and Frederick (b) 1803 . The latter was a Cordwainer&lt;br&gt;and had 13 children , most dying young . Of these Joseph Elijah&lt;br&gt;emigrated to Lafayette , Indiana in 1870 &amp;amp; became a lawyer.&lt;br&gt;Robert , married 3 times , last to Mary Ann Brooks having 10&lt;br&gt;children . He lived in Hopton &amp;amp; was a veterinary surgeon . In 1870&lt;br&gt;his sons  George J &amp;amp; John Middleton also settled in Lafayette&lt;br&gt;becoming a Federal Judge &amp;amp; Shoe merchant . In 1881, another son, Joseph Brooks  ( a butcher ) emigrated to Kaufman, Texas.&lt;br&gt;Another son William Frost E may also have emigrated at the same time but returned in about 3 years( mystery here ),married&lt;br&gt;Sarah Fisher &amp;amp; settled at Mill Pond Farm in S. Lopham, Norfolk,&lt;br&gt;raising 9 children .My father was Harold Frank E . I was the only male of th next generation . We&lt;br&gt;are in touch with several descendants in the U S A .&lt;br&gt;I would appreciate a tree of the Suffolk family &l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;</description>

      <description>Hi Jenna&lt;br&gt;Have you solved your problem with Gilbert William &amp;amp; Frank. I don't know if any of this information will help but it seems from my searches that Gilbert William had a brother Arthur Henry born 1884 and 1882 respectively in Colwall of Thomas and Mary Willoughby (Thomas' parents were William and Elizabeth Nash).  Both Gilbert and Arthur are living in Darton Yorkshire in the 1901 Census, Gilbert is listed as a Colliery Horse Driver Underground and Arthur as a Horseman on a farm. Have no Frank Eacock on my research so maybe you could fill me in there.  Any information you can exchange would be greatly appreciated.&lt;br&gt;Kind regards&lt;br&gt;Cathy</description>

      <description>HIi Jenna&lt;br&gt;     My maiden name is Eacock. While I was researching my family history Ia letter came into my hands regarding a Guilbert Eacock who's brother Arther  changed is name to Clark. The story as far as this letter goes, is that their mother Mary maiden name Willoughby left her husband Thomas Eacock to set up home with a Addam Clark apparently they moved around the country.and had address's in Preshore, Sratford.  Towcester, Barnsley, and Huddersfield. The family originates from Colwal Hereford. IF you find that this is the family you are looking for I would be happy to share what I have. Heather.</description>
